CVE-2026-42253 1 Apache 2 Activemq, Activemq Web 2026-07-22 N/A 6.1 MEDIUM
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ting') vulnerability in Apache ActiveMQ, Apache ActiveMQ Web. The MessageServlet in the ActiveMQ web console API copies every JMS message property into an HTTP response header without any validation. This can allow overwriting and injecting security headers by setting them on JMS messages that are returned by the servlet. This issue affects Apache ActiveMQ: before 5.19.7, from 6.0.0 before 6.2.6; Apache ActiveMQ Web: before 5.19.7, from 6.0.0 before 6.2.6.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 5.19.7 or 6.2.6, which fixes the issue. The MessageServlet has now been deprecated and disabled by default.
CVE-2026-48559 2026-07-22 N/A 5.4 MEDIUM
Lightweight Music Server (LMS) though 3.76.0 contains a stored cross-site scripting vulnerability that allows attackers to execute arbitrary JavaScript by embedding malicious HTML in media file metadata tags such as GENRE, ARTIST, or ALBUM. Attackers can introduce a crafted media file into the victim's library, causing the payload to be saved during library scanning and executed automatically in the web interface due to tag content being rendered using Wt::TextFormat::UnsafeXHTML without sanitization in src/lms/ui/Utils.cpp.

CVE-2026-45668 2026-07-22 N/A N/A
Trilium Notes is a cross-platform, hierarchical note taking application focused on building large personal knowledge bases. Prior to 0.102.2, a malicious ZIP archive imported with safe import enabled achieves RCE via #docName path traversal and XSS by combining a payload note (type: code, mime: text/plain) containing raw HTML/JS and a trigger note (type: doc or type: launcher) with a #docName label that uses ../ path traversal to point at the payload note's API endpoint. The desktop client Electron renderer runs with nodeIntegration enabled, so an RCE is triggered once the payload is executed. This vulnerability is fixed in 0.102.2.

CVE-2026-44651 2026-07-22 N/A N/A
SillyTavern is a locally installed user interface that allows users to interact with text generation large language models, image generation engines, and text-to-speech voice models. Prior to 1.18.0, when fetch(url) throws, the code sends: res.status(500).send('Error occurred while trying to proxy to: ' + url + ' ' + error). The url value is attacker-controlled (req.params.url) and is not HTML-escaped before rendering.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.18.0.

CVE-2026-45270 2026-07-21 N/A 8.7 HIGH
CI4MS is a CodeIgniter 4-based content management system skeleton. Prior to version 0.31.9.0, the `Pages` backend module registers the `html_purify` validation rule on language-keyed page content but persists the raw, un-purified POST value into the database. The public renderer for pages (`Home::index()` → `app/Views/templates/default/pages.php`) emits `$pageInfo->content` without `esc()`, yielding stored XSS that fires for every public visitor of the affected page — including administrators. Because pages may be promoted to the site home page, the payload can be served at `/` and reach every visitor of the site. Version 0.31.9.0 patches the issue.
CVE-2026-45138 2026-07-21 N/A 5.4 MEDIUM
CI4MS is a CodeIgniter 4-based content management system skeleton. Prior to version 0.31.9.0, the custom `html_purify` validation rule used to sanitize blog post bodies relies on by-reference mutation (`?string &$str`), but CodeIgniter 4's validator passes a local copy of the value, so the sanitized text is silently discarded. The Blog controller writes `$lanData['content']` directly into `blog_langs.content`, and the public template echoes it without escaping — yielding stored XSS executable in any visitor's browser, including the superadmin when previewing or editing posts. Version 0.31.9.0 patches the issue.

CVE-2026-58411 2026-07-21 N/A N/A
ChurchCRM is an open-source church management system. Prior to version 7.4.0,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ities were identified due to insufficient output encoding of user-controlled request parameter names and parameter values. The application reflects attacker-controlled input into JavaScript string contexts and HTML attribute contexts without proper sanitization or contextual output encoding. Affected endpoints observed during testing: /FamilyCustomFieldsEditor.php, /PaddleNumList.php and /admin/system/church-info. Potential consequences include session-token theft, account takeover, unauthorized actions on behalf of authenticated users, exposure of sensitive church member information, credential harvesting, phishing, and privilege escalation when administrators are targeted. This issue has been resolved in version 7.4.0.
